Step 10Check fork alignment

Check fork alignment
Once it was tack welded solidly, I checked the entire fork for alignment by looking down the length while the front wheel was installed (Photo 10). If all checks out, then apply the final welds to the fork stem and fork legs, if not, you know what to do (chop, chop).

If there is only a slight misalignment between the legs, you may be able to just twist the fork while holding the wheel solid to put it back straight. If the entire thing looks like it was thrown off a bridge, then break those task welds and try again.
